Lines Matching defs:dig_port
30 static bool intel_tc_port_in_mode(struct intel_digital_port *dig_port, in intel_tc_port_in_mode()
39 bool intel_tc_port_in_tbt_alt_mode(struct intel_digital_port *dig_port) in intel_tc_port_in_tbt_alt_mode()
44 bool intel_tc_port_in_dp_alt_mode(struct intel_digital_port *dig_port) in intel_tc_port_in_dp_alt_mode()
49 bool intel_tc_port_in_legacy_mode(struct intel_digital_port *dig_port) in intel_tc_port_in_legacy_mode()
54 bool intel_tc_cold_requires_aux_pw(struct intel_digital_port *dig_port) in intel_tc_cold_requires_aux_pw()
63 tc_cold_get_power_domain(struct intel_digital_port *dig_port, enum tc_port_mode mode) in tc_cold_get_power_domain()
74 tc_cold_block_in_mode(struct intel_digital_port *dig_port, enum tc_port_mode mode, in tc_cold_block_in_mode()
85 tc_cold_block(struct intel_digital_port *dig_port, enum intel_display_power_domain *domain) in tc_cold_block()
91 tc_cold_unblock(struct intel_digital_port *dig_port, enum intel_display_power_domain domain, in tc_cold_unblock()
108 assert_tc_cold_blocked(struct intel_digital_port *dig_port) in assert_tc_cold_blocked()
119 u32 intel_tc_port_get_lane_mask(struct intel_digital_port *dig_port) in intel_tc_port_get_lane_mask()
135 u32 intel_tc_port_get_pin_assignment_mask(struct intel_digital_port *dig_port) in intel_tc_port_get_pin_assignment_mask()
151 int intel_tc_port_fia_max_lane_count(struct intel_digital_port *dig_port) in intel_tc_port_fia_max_lane_count()
183 void intel_tc_port_set_fia_lane_count(struct intel_digital_port *dig_port, in intel_tc_port_set_fia_lane_count()
222 static void tc_port_fixup_legacy_flag(struct intel_digital_port *dig_port, in tc_port_fixup_legacy_flag()
245 static u32 icl_tc_port_live_status_mask(struct intel_digital_port *dig_port) in icl_tc_port_live_status_mask()
278 static u32 adl_tc_port_live_status_mask(struct intel_digital_port *dig_port) in adl_tc_port_live_status_mask()
307 static u32 tc_port_live_status_mask(struct intel_digital_port *dig_port) in tc_port_live_status_mask()
325 static bool icl_tc_phy_status_complete(struct intel_digital_port *dig_port) in icl_tc_phy_status_complete()
350 static bool adl_tc_phy_status_complete(struct intel_digital_port *dig_port) in adl_tc_phy_status_complete()
368 static bool tc_phy_status_complete(struct intel_digital_port *dig_port) in tc_phy_status_complete()
378 static bool icl_tc_phy_take_ownership(struct intel_digital_port *dig_port, in icl_tc_phy_take_ownership()
405 static bool adl_tc_phy_take_ownership(struct intel_digital_port *dig_port, in adl_tc_phy_take_ownership()
423 static bool tc_phy_take_ownership(struct intel_digital_port *dig_port, bool take) in tc_phy_take_ownership()
433 static bool icl_tc_phy_is_owned(struct intel_digital_port *dig_port) in icl_tc_phy_is_owned()
451 static bool adl_tc_phy_is_owned(struct intel_digital_port *dig_port) in adl_tc_phy_is_owned()
462 static bool tc_phy_is_owned(struct intel_digital_port *dig_port) in tc_phy_is_owned()
483 static void icl_tc_phy_connect(struct intel_digital_port *dig_port, in icl_tc_phy_connect()
548 static void icl_tc_phy_disconnect(struct intel_digital_port *dig_port) in icl_tc_phy_disconnect()
565 static bool icl_tc_phy_is_connected(struct intel_digital_port *dig_port) in icl_tc_phy_is_connected()
591 intel_tc_port_get_current_mode(struct intel_digital_port *dig_port) in intel_tc_port_get_current_mode()
613 intel_tc_port_get_target_mode(struct intel_digital_port *dig_port) in intel_tc_port_get_target_mode()
623 static void intel_tc_port_reset_mode(struct intel_digital_port *dig_port, in intel_tc_port_reset_mode()
649 static bool intel_tc_port_needs_reset(struct intel_digital_port *dig_port) in intel_tc_port_needs_reset()
654 static void intel_tc_port_update_mode(struct intel_digital_port *dig_port, in intel_tc_port_update_mode()
687 intel_tc_port_link_init_refcount(struct intel_digital_port *dig_port, in intel_tc_port_link_init_refcount()
696 void intel_tc_port_sanitize(struct intel_digital_port *dig_port) in intel_tc_port_sanitize()
762 struct intel_digital_port *dig_port = enc_to_dig_port(encoder); in intel_tc_port_connected() local
775 static void __intel_tc_port_lock(struct intel_digital_port *dig_port, in __intel_tc_port_lock()
793 void intel_tc_port_lock(struct intel_digital_port *dig_port) in intel_tc_port_lock()
808 struct intel_digital_port *dig_port = in intel_tc_port_disconnect_phy_work() local
825 void intel_tc_port_flush_work(struct intel_digital_port *dig_port) in intel_tc_port_flush_work()
830 void intel_tc_port_unlock(struct intel_digital_port *dig_port) in intel_tc_port_unlock()
839 bool intel_tc_port_ref_held(struct intel_digital_port *dig_port) in intel_tc_port_ref_held()
845 void intel_tc_port_get_link(struct intel_digital_port *dig_port, in intel_tc_port_get_link()
853 void intel_tc_port_put_link(struct intel_digital_port *dig_port) in intel_tc_port_put_link()
869 tc_has_modular_fia(struct drm_i915_private *i915, struct intel_digital_port *dig_port) in tc_has_modular_fia()
890 tc_port_load_fia_params(struct drm_i915_private *i915, struct intel_digital_port *dig_port) in tc_port_load_fia_params()
908 void intel_tc_port_init(struct intel_digital_port *dig_port, bool is_legacy) in intel_tc_port_init()